IT’S the movie that everyone’s talking about, yet no one has even seen yet.

The Oscar buzz around Birdman is already mounting after a whopping seven Golden Globe nominations, and four SAG award noms it received earlier this week, the most of any film.

The black comedy stars Michael Keaton as the title character with supporting roles from Zach Galifianakis, Edward Norton, Andrea Riseborough, Amy Ryan, Emma Stone, and our own Naomi Watts.

Birdman is an ageing Hollywood star once famous for portraying an iconic superhero and his desperate struggle to revive his career in a Broadway play.

And it’s already been met with universal critical acclaim.

Rotten Tomatoes gave a whopping 94 per cent approval rate of 167 reviews, with the critics consensus unanimous in it’s praise.

“A thrilling leap forward for director Alejandro González Iñárritu,” the consensus said, “Birdman is an ambitious technical showcase powered by a layered story and outstanding performances from Michael Keaton and Edward Norton.”

While Variety called it “a triumph on every creative level” and Britain’s The Telegraph gave the film an extremely rare five stars.

Critics are already predicting that Keaton will be a frontrunner for an Academy Award for Best Actor.

But if you want to see it, you’ll have to wait as the film isn’t released until January 15 next year.
